craftswoman
[ krafts-woom-uhn ]
noun
, plural crafts·wom·en.
- a woman who practices or is highly skilled in a craft; artisan.

Word History and Origins
Origin of craftswoman1
First recorded in 1885–90; crafts(man) + -woman
